Identifying Seasonal Fashion Trends with Data

Seasonality plays a significant role in the fashion industry, with trends often aligning with specific times of the year. Google Trends enables fashion sites to identify these seasonal patterns by providing data on how search interest fluctuates throughout the year. By understanding these patterns, brands can strategically plan their content to align with consumer demand, ensuring they capture the attention of their target audience at the right time.

For instance, searches for "summer dresses" are likely to peak in the months leading up to summer, while interest in "winter coats" typically increases as temperatures drop. By leveraging this data, fashion sites can align their content calendar with these peaks, maximizing their visibility and engagement. This alignment not only boosts traffic but also increases the likelihood of conversions as consumers are more likely to purchase items they are actively searching for.

In addition to identifying seasonal trends, Google Trends can also help fashion sites uncover new and unexpected patterns. For example, an unexpected surge in searches for a particular color or style can indicate the emergence of a micro-trend. By capitalizing on these insights, fashion brands can position themselves as trendsetters and gain a competitive edge in the industry.

Analyzing Consumer Behavior for Content Strategy

Understanding consumer behavior is key to developing a successful content strategy. Google Trends offers valuable insights into the interests and preferences of fashion consumers, allowing brands to tailor their content to meet these needs. By analyzing search data, fashion sites can gain a deeper understanding of what their audience is looking for, enabling them to create content that is both relevant and engaging.

One effective way to analyze consumer behavior is by examining related queries and rising search terms. These insights can reveal what other topics or items consumers are interested in, providing opportunities for fashion sites to expand their content offerings. For example, if searches for "sustainable fashion" are on the rise, a fashion site can create content around eco-friendly brands, sustainable styling tips, and ethical fashion news to attract this audience.

Additionally, fashion sites can use Google Trends to track the effectiveness of their content. By monitoring changes in search interest after publishing a new article or launching a marketing campaign, brands can assess what resonates with their audience and refine their strategies accordingly. This data-driven approach ensures that content remains dynamic and continuously aligned with consumer interests.
